On 08/27, Christophe JAILLET wrote: > Check memory allocation failures and return -ENOMEM in such cases, as > already done few lines below for another memory allocation. > > This avoids NULL pointers dereference. > > Fixes: 14e494542636 ("libnvdimm, btt: BTT updates for UEFI 2.7 format") > Signed-off-by: Christophe JAILLET <christophe.jaillet@wanadoo.fr> > --- > drivers/nvdimm/btt.c | 2 ++ > 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
Looks good, thank you. Reviewed-by: Vishal Verma <vishal.l.verma@intel.com>
> > diff --git a/drivers/nvdimm/btt.c b/drivers/nvdimm/btt.c > index 60491641a8d6..607184ebcfbf 100644 > --- a/drivers/nvdimm/btt.c > +++ b/drivers/nvdimm/btt.c > @@ -1431,6 +1431,8 @@ int nvdimm_namespace_attach_btt(struct nd_namespace_common *ndns) > } > > btt_sb = devm_kzalloc(&nd_btt->dev, sizeof(*btt_sb), GFP_KERNEL); > + if (!btt_sb) > + return -ENOMEM; > > /* > * If this returns < 0, that is ok as it just means there wasn't > -- > 2.11.0 >
